The primary responsibility of the ***Inventory & Material Coordinator*** is to help meet the inventory and material needs of the construction division and its crews by maintaining a clean and organized inventory warehouse and to be the key point of contact for daily material needs.
**The key roles include the following:**
* Manage Inventory
* Organize Warehouse
* Receiving Inventory
* Issuing Inventory
* Material Transportation
**Duties and Responsibilities Include:**
* Receive deliveries, scan and upload package slips to appropriate job
* Notify Project Managers of material deliveries in a timely manner
* Label, stage, and organize material per job
* Allocate required items to jobs with purchase orders
* Allocate & bill materials to specific jobs
* Issue and record inventory in the BPG systems
* Maintenance of inventory log with issuance of materials by job
* Monthly inventory of on-hand material for customers
* Maintain a clean and organized warehouse
* Manage recycling on a regular basis
* Management of Cox Inventory & Material process via CMAC
* Management of material loading and transportation to jobs sites
**Basic Qualifications:**
* **Valid Arizona Driver's License** with clean MVR (5 year minimum)
* Proficient in Microsoft Office programs
* Ability to work flexible hours, as needed
* Ability to communicate personally and via telephone/email
* Ability to function independently and as part of a team
* High School Diploma or equivalent
* Experience in the Telecommunications industry, a plus
**Physical Demands/Work Environment**
* Frequent holding and grasping with hands
* Frequent use of feet to operate pedals on equipment/trucks
* Constant standing, stooping, kneeling, and carrying and lifting (20lbs. - 100lbs.)
* Exposure to bright lights, extreme temperatures, loud noise, dust, gas, and fumes
